Cultural Context

Originating from the Lyon region of France, quenelles are a classic dish made from finely ground fish or meat, combined with a light batter. Traditionally served in a rich sauce, they are a testament to French culinary finesse, showcasing the art of transforming simple ingredients into delicate dumplings. Today, variations abound, with chefs experimenting with different fillings and sauces, making quenelles a beloved dish in both home kitchens and fine dining establishments.

1

Prepare the fish fillets by removing skin and bones.

2

Chop the fish fillets finely or pulse in a food processor until smooth.

3

In a bowl, mix the fish with eggs, salt, white pepper, and nutmeg until well combined.

4

Gradually add heavy cream while mixing to create a smooth batter.

5

Fold in flour gently until just incorporated.

6

Chill the mixture in the refrigerator for 30 minutes to firm up.

7

Bring a pot of fish stock to a simmer over medium heat.

8

Shape the chilled mixture into oval dumplings using two spoons.

9

Carefully drop the quenelles into the simmering stock and poach for 10-12 minutes until firm.

10

Remove the quenelles with a slotted spoon and set aside.

11

In a separate pan, melt butter and sauté chopped onion, garlic, and mushrooms until softened.

12

Add lemon juice and parsley to the sautéed mixture, then serve over the quenelles.
